What will the weather in Suihua be like during my visit?
The warmest months in Suihua are usually July and June with an average temp of 68°F. January and December are the chilliest months when the average temp is 6°F. The rainiest months are July and August.

Things to do in Suihua

Suihua invites travelers to explore its stunning blend of lush forests, serene lakes, and rolling hills. Nature enthusiasts can hike scenic trails, while tranquil parks offer perfect spots for picnics. The area's rich natural beauty promises a refreshing escape, making it an ideal destination for outdoor lovers.

  • Balicheng RuinsOpens in a new window – Step back in time at this historic site, where ancient remnants whisper tales of the past. Explore the ruins surrounded by nature, and capture stunning photographs of the landscape framed by these archaeological treasures.
  • Dongfu Folk Custom ParkOpens in a new window – Discover the vibrant local culture at Dongfu Folk Custom Park, where traditional crafts and folk performances bring the area’s heritage to life. Wander through picturesque pathways and enjoy the unique atmosphere created by the colorful displays and lively events.
  • Longfeng MarshOpens in a new window – Experience the serene beauty of Longfeng Marsh, a wetland teeming with wildlife. Bring your binoculars for birdwatching or simply relax as you stroll along the trails, soaking in the sights and sounds of nature all around you.
  • Daqing Dahua ParkOpens in a new window – Enjoy a leisurely day at Daqing Dahua Park, an urban oasis perfect for picnicking and outdoor activities. Relax under the shade of trees, take a refreshing walk along the paths, or engage in recreational activities with family and friends.
  • Hulan Catholic ChurchOpens in a new window – Marvel at the architecture of Hulan Catholic Church, a serene spot for reflection. Step inside to appreciate the beautiful interiors and the peaceful ambiance that invites quiet contemplation or a moment of prayer.
